gprscomp.c: DMEM_PARTITION_1_SIZE bumped from 1600 to 1700 for gcc
These large DMEM partitions are used for T_CCD_Globs structure allocations
by the GRLC and GRR entities, and this structure contains a jmp_buf
for setjmp/longjmp. Our gcc/newlib version of jmp_buf is bigger than
TI's TMS470, and the whole structure is now 1636 bytes instead of 1584.
